The Role

You will be supporting children in Nursery or Reception who require additional help to access learning and develop socially, emotionally, and academically. Many of the children supported in this role have EHCPs or are in the early stages of assessment.

Your work will focus on helping children develop:

  • Communication and language skills

  • Social interaction and play skills

  • Emotional regulation and confidence

  • Independence and self-care

You will work closely with the class teacher to adapt activities and routines to meet individual needs.

Key Duties and Responsibilities

  • Deliver 1:1 and small-group SEN support

  • Implement strategies and interventions set by the SENCo and external specialists

  • Support children during play, learning activities, and transitions

  • Use visual timetables, now-and-next boards, and sensory resources

  • Promote positive behaviour and inclusion

  • Support with personal care and toileting where necessary

  • Observe and record progress and contribute to review meetings

  • Maintain safeguarding and child protection standards
